What Are the Key Benefits of a Hydrogen Compressor?

Author: Jessica

Apr. 23, 2026

In recent years, the demand for efficient and sustainable energy solutions has led to the increased utilization of hydrogen as a clean fuel source. At the forefront of this technological advancement are hydrogen compressors, essential devices engineered to enhance the efficiency of hydrogen production, storage, and transportation. Understanding the key benefits of a hydrogen compressor not only illuminates its importance in the modern energy landscape but also underscores why businesses and industries are increasingly adopting this technology.

One of the primary advantages of using a hydrogen compressor is improving the efficiency of hydrogen storage and transportation. Hydrogen, being the lightest element, is challenging to store in its gaseous state. A hydrogen compressor works by increasing the pressure of hydrogen gas, enabling it to occupy a smaller volume. This not only simplifies storage but also reduces transportation costs, making hydrogen a more viable fuel option for businesses and industries aiming to switch to greener energy solutions.

Another significant benefit of a hydrogen compressor lies in its role in enhancing safety during the storage and transportation of hydrogen. By compressing hydrogen into tanks designed to handle high pressures, the risk of leaks is minimized. Today’s hydrogen compressors are built with advanced safety features that monitor pressure levels and detect potential failures, ensuring that hydrogen can be safely transported over long distances. This is crucial in industries such as automotive, where hydrogen fuel cell technology is gaining traction as an alternative to traditional fossil fuels.

Hydrogen compressors also contribute to environmental sustainability. As hydrogen is produced from various renewable sources, including water and biomass, compressing it for use in fuel cells helps reduce dependency on fossil fuels. This not only lowers greenhouse gas emissions but also supports global goals for reducing carbon footprints. Many companies are actively investing in hydrogen infrastructure, including compressors, to align with their sustainability objectives, highlighting a profound shift towards green energy solutions.

Versatility is another hallmark of the hydrogen compressor. It can be applied across multiple sectors, from energy production and storage facilities to transportation and automotive industries. For example, in the automotive sector, hydrogen compressors are critical for refueling hydrogen fuel cell vehicles quickly and efficiently, enabling a practical solution for consumers eager to embrace clean energy in their daily lives. Their adaptability makes them a valuable asset in the transition to hydrogen fuel as a mainstream energy source.

Moreover, advancements in technology have led to the development of more compact and energy-efficient hydrogen compressors. Modern systems utilize innovative designs and materials that enhance performance while reducing energy consumption. This not only leads to cost savings for companies using hydrogen compressors but also ensures they remain competitive in an ever-evolving energy market. Industries are thus incentivized to adopt these technologies to improve their operational efficiency and sustainability.

In addition, hydrogen compressors provide a seamless integration with renewable energy systems. For instance, when used in conjunction with wind or solar power systems, hydrogen compressors can help store excess energy produced during peak production times. This stored hydrogen can then be converted back into electricity or used as fuel when energy demands exceed production, exemplifying a closed-loop energy solution that minimizes waste and maximizes resource efficiency.

Finally, as industries push toward decarbonization, the demand for hydrogen compressors is expected to see significant growth. Government initiatives and incentives promoting the adoption of hydrogen as an alternative fuel are likely to create further opportunities for businesses that integrate these systems into their operations.

In conclusion, the key benefits of a hydrogen compressor are vast and impactful. By improving storage and transportation efficiency, enhancing safety, supporting sustainability, offering versatility, and integrating seamlessly with renewable systems, hydrogen compressors play a crucial role in ushering in a new era of clean energy.
